Subject: Uniform shipment — Netherby Depot

Dispatch: four crates of uniforms for the new Netherby Depot go out Friday with Swiftgale Transit. Receiving site should count crates against the manifest before signing. Shortages reported within 24 hours or they won't be honoured. Storage room must be cleared beforehand. The courier hand-over instruction is as follows:

handover note for yagef-bagep: the drudor pelius courier leaves the kasdor zorvan norir ledger at gate 8016 under passcode 755406

Migration step 4 — Spoolhaven printer-spooler service. Welcome aboard. At this point the legacy daemon on the Kettering cluster should be drained; verify the queue depth reads zero before proceeding. Copy the job archive to the new volume, then register the microservice with the Lanthorn discovery layer. It will refuse to start until its settings file is in place, so create it with the following configuration values.

config for kafof-bawef:
holath:
  log_level: debug
  metrics_host: metrics.holath.qorvelsys.internal
  pin: 2191
  pool_size: 32

As a contractor, one of the first components you'll touch is Gaugework, our metrics-aggregation sidecar. It runs alongside every service pod, scrapes local counters every ten seconds, batches them, and forwards the results to the central Tallyhouse cluster. Configuration lives in each service's deploy manifest under the gaugework block; most defaults are fine. Before changing flush intervals or label cardinality, read the operational guidelines. The full sidecar runbook is on the internal page below.

wiki page, fahaf-yagag: https://confluence.qorvellabs.internal/pages/display/pages/display